A Journey Through Education
Upon entering, the atmosphere is filled with nostalgia, as artifacts from various eras are showcased. Vintage classroom setups recreate the experience of learning in days gone by. Desks, chalkboards, and textbooks from the past tell stories that resonate with those who have walked the halls of education. The museum's collection illustrates the dramatic changes in teaching methods and materials, offering a fascinating glimpse into how education has evolved over time.
Visitors are transported to the late 19th and early 20th centuries, when schooling became more structured and accessible. The exhibits detail the introduction of compulsory education and the impact it had on society. Photographs and documents reveal the faces of students and teachers who shaped the educational landscape. Such historical context adds depth to the understanding of contemporary schooling.

Interactive Exhibits
One of the museum's highlights is the opportunity for hands-on learning. Interactive displays allow visitors to experience the pedagogical tools used in the past. Children and adults alike can try their hand at writing with quills, solving math problems on chalkboards, or even participating in mock lessons. This engaging approach invites connection with history, making it more relatable and enjoyable.
